BIAPA engineer caught accepting bribe
Bangalore, Sep 16 (UNI) Sleuths of the Karnataka Lok Ayukta have caught a junior engineer, working in Bangalore International Airport Planning Authority, while accepting a bribe of Rs 3.5 lakh from a builder for issuing no-objection certificate for conversion of agriculture land.
Speaking to newspersons here today, Lok Ayukta Mr Justice Santosh Hegde said the builder complained to them that the engineer H R Vishwanath had demanded the bribe to issue the certificate for converting a land in Devanahalli taluk of Bangalore Rural district for commercial use. Following this, a trap was laid last evening and Vishwanath was caught red handed while accepting the bribe at a city hotel.
